’I try to leave him alone’: Swan tight-lipped on Dusty’s future

Collingwood Hall of Famer Dane Swan says his close mate, Tigers star Dustin Martin, must do what’s best for him as speculation swirls about the Richmond star’s future.

Collingwood Hall of Famer Dane Swan has urged his great mate Dustin Martin to do what’s right for him.

The former star midfielder says he hasn’t yet planned a post-season trip with the Tigers great but is well aware of speculation swirling about Martin’s future after his 300th match two weeks ago.

“Your guess is as good as mine,’’ Swan said.

“When we are together I don’t like to ask him those things. He’s at training this week so I assume he’ll play.

“I think the world would know so that mail was obviously wrong. I just want what’s best for Dustin, if that’s playing one more game and finishing on 301, or playing another three years at Richmond or moving to the Gold Coast ... it’s what’s best for him.

“I just try to leave him alone as much as I can and not ask because then I don’t need to lie to anyone.”

Swan, who was elevated into the Australian Football Hall of Fame last week, is back to work after the long night of celebrations.

A co-owner of two venues, The Union Hotel and The Osborne, he filmed a commercial on Tuesday for Houdini Plumbing, who have made big strides in the electrical heat pump space and who have also engaged footy legends Sam Newman and Wayne Carey.

“My life hasn’t changed much,’’ Swan said.

“The next day or so when we got home I sat on the couch and (my partner) Taylor was doing all the cleaning up and I said I’m a Hall of Famer now, I don’t do that kind of stuff.

“She called me some things you probably can’t print so I promptly got up and helped with the housework.

“It was nice to get everyone together. That’s what I enjoyed most about it.”
